Duff House is a magnificent Georgian mansion designed by William Adam.
It contains a collection of important works from National Galleries Scotland and the Magdalene Sharpe Erskine Trust. Learn the many stories of Duff House’s history, from a royal visit to its wartime use as a prisoner-of-war camp.
